buzz

Definition

  • verb: to make the low, continuous sound of a flying insect (such as a bee)
  • verb: to make a low continuous humming sound like that of a bee
  • often + 'for'
  • synonyms: whisper, hum, ring

Examples

  • The hall 'buzzed' with excitement as the audience waited for the show to start.

  • She 'buzzed' her secretary to say she was going out for lunch.

  • The plane/pilot 'buzzed' the people watching the show.
